#71303c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71303c is composed of 44.3% red, 18.8%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.5%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 348.9 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 31.6%. #71303c color hex could be obtained by blending #e26078 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#71303c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71303c has RGB values of R:113, G:48,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.47,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7417916.

Shades and Tints of #71303c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#faf4f5 is the lightest one.
